Arsenal loanee Jack Wilshere regaining fitness by training less

Bournemouth manager Eddie Howe has revealed that Jack Wilshere is regaining his fitness by training less according to the Mirror. Per-the-source, Wilshere is expected to make his debut for the Cherries this weekend against West Brom. However, Howe has stated that they are keeping the Arsenal loanee wrapped in cotton wool following his recent injury record. 'He has not completed all of the training,' Howe told BBC Radio Solent (via the Mirror). 'We have had to manage his training time on the pitch to make sure we get the balance right between getting him fitter and making sure he does not break down.
